Holocene environment change in Hai Phong coastal area was reconstructed based on diatom and grain-size analysis in the HP1 core at Duong Kinh, Hai Phong. 52 diatom species were identified and divided in five diatom ecozones by changing of four diatom groups including marine planktonic, brackish planktonic, brackish benthic and freshwater one. The sedimentary environment at the Hai Phong coastal area was estuary- bay condition in the Flandrian trangression (Z1, Z2 and Z3 Unit). Deltaic environment changed from prodelta (Z4), delta front (Z5) to delta plain (Z6 and Z7) corresponding to the Flandrian regression.
